Tammy Wynette’s Former Estate Is on the Market for a Cool $5.5 Million [Photo Gallery]

Tammy’s Wynette’s former estate, dubbed First Lady Acres, is on the market for a cool $5.5 million. Constructed in 1970, Tammy’s husband George Jones purchased the almost-10,000-square-foot property in 1974. The nine-bedroom, nine-bath house remained Tammy’s primary residence until 1992. Lauren Alaina Lives a Country Song in New Single, “Doin’ Fine” [Listen]

Lauren Alaina followed up her first-ever No. 1 single, “Road Less Traveled,” by releasing “Doin’ Fine” to country radio on May 22.
